> + • Internal or External reference voltage. > + • Support 2 Internal reference voltage 1.2v or 2.5v. > + • Integrate dividing circuit for battery sensing. > > properties: > compatible: > enum: > - aspeed,ast2400-adc > - aspeed,ast2500-adc > + - aspeed,ast2600-adc > > reg: > maxItems: 1 > @@ -33,6 +45,18 @@ properties: > "#io-channel-cells": > const: 1 > > + vref: > + minItems: 900 > + maxItems: 2700 > + default: 2500 > + description: > + ADC Reference voltage in millivolts.
I'm not clear from this description. Is this describing an externally connected voltage reference? If so it needs to be done as a regulator. If it's a classic high precision reference, the dts can just use a fixed regulator.
> + > + battery-sensing: > + type: boolean > + description: > + Inform the driver that last channel will be used to sensor battery.
This isn't (I think?) a standard dt binding, so it needs a manufacturer prefix.
aspeed,battery-sensing
